Instrucciones

  • 1 - Prepare Marinade:
    In a bowl, mix together ol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, oregano, salt, and pepper to create the marinade.
  • 2 - Marinate Chicken:
    Add chicken pieces to the marinade, cover, and refrigerate for at least 15 minutes or longer for more flavor.
  • 3 - Prep Skewers:
    Thread marinated chicken onto soaked skewers, alternating with bell pepper and onion pieces for added flavor and color.
  • 4 - Grill Skewers:
    Preheat a grill over medium-high heat. Grill the skewers for about 10-15 minutes, turning occasionally until evenly cooked.
  • 5 - Serve:
    Remove from the grill and let them rest for a few minutes. Serve hot with tzatziki sauce and fresh pita.

Souvlaki Skewers

Souvlaki skewers are a staple of Greek cuisine, reflecting the rich family traditions of enjoying grilled meats seasoned perfectly with aromatic herbs. The classic combination of simple ingredients such as chicken, herbs, and a marinade of olive oil and lemon creates a delicious dish embodies the essence of the Mediterranean diet. Traditionally, souvlaki is often enjoyed either as a quick snack or a flavorful meal alongside pita bread and refreshing tzatziki sauce. In Greece, you might find these skewers available in street corners, showcasing how accessible and loved they are.

Tips for best results:

  • Always soak wooden skewers in water for a few hours before grilling to prevent burning.
  • Experiment with marinating longer for more intense flavor. You can even use pork or lamb if preferred.
  • Serve with a salad or grilled veggies for a balanced meal.
